Today’s Most Interesting Wine Industry Data
“The median winery sells about two-thirds direct and one-third wholesale. That balance flips with size: small wineries live on DTC margin, and the largest producers run almost entirely on wholesale volume. DTC share generally declines as production rises, and the crossover from direct-dominant to wholesale-dominant lands right around 10,000 cases.”
